痛风性关节炎湿热蕴结证大鼠模型建立的研究 被引量:11

Study of the Establishment of the Gouty Arthritis Rat Models with Damp-heat Syndrome

摘要 目的探究建立痛风性关节炎湿热蕴结证大鼠模型的方法。方法选用健康成年SD雄性大鼠40只,按随机法将大鼠分为4组:正常对照组(A组),痛风组(B组),湿热组(C组),痛风加湿热模型组(D组),每组10只。各组经不同的处理或造模后,观察大鼠的一般状态,用Bradford法检测大鼠尿液水通道蛋白2(AQP2),放射免疫法检测内皮素(ET)、降钙素基因相关肽(CGRP),ELISA法定量测定热休克蛋白70(HSP70),HE染色、光镜下观察大鼠踝关节滑膜组织、舌组织。结果一般状态,C、D组符合湿热证的表现,B、D组符合痛风性关节炎的表现。尿液AQP2:A、B组高于C组和D组(P<0.05)。血浆ET:A组低于B、C、D组(P<0.05),B组低于C、D组(P<0.05),C组低于D组(P<0.05)。血浆CGRP:A组高于B、C、D组(P<0.05),B组低于C组和D组(P<0.05),C组低于D组(P<0.05)。血清HSP70:B、D组高于A、C组(P<0.05)。结论在高脂高糖饮食+湿热环境+关节腔注射药物的复合干预下,可以成功复制痛风性关节炎湿热蕴结证的大鼠动物模型。 Objective To explore the methods for building the gouty arthritis rat models with damp-heat syndrome. Methods 40 healthy adult SD male rats were divided into 4 groups: normal control group (group A), gout group (group B), damp-heat group (group C), gout with damp-heat group (group D), 10 in each group. The general status of the rats was observed before and after establishment. The water rat urine protein channel 2 (AQP2) was detected by Bradford method; the endothelin (ET) and calcitonin gene-related peptide (CGRP) were measured by radiation immune method. HSPT0 was detected by ELISA method. The rats were dyed by HE. Synovial and tongue tissues of ankles in rats were observed by light-microscopy. Results In the general status, group C and D showed the manifestations in hot and humid, group B and D were in accordance with the performance of gouty arthritis. Urine AQP2 in group A and B was higher than that in group C and D (P〈 0.05). The content of plasma ET in group A was lower than that in group B, C and D (P〈 0.05), group B was lower than Group C and D, and group C was lower than group D (P 〈 0.05). Plasma CGRP in group A was higher than that in group B, C and D (P〈 0.05), group B is lower than group C and group D (P〈 0.05), group C is lower than group D (P〈 0.05). Serum HSPT0 in group B and D were higher than group A and C (P 〈 0.05). Conclusion Under the comprehensive intervention of the high fat and sugar diet + damp-heat environment + articular cavity drug injection, the gouty arthritis rat models with damp-heat syndrome can be built successfully.
